あるフォルダに入っているファイルを、指定した数区切りで別フォルダに格納していくアプリケーションを作りたいと
思っているのですが、C言語で組むかJava言語で組むか迷っています。
①ファイルが入っているフォルダを指定
②移動先フォルダを指定
③ファイルを何個区切りで分けるか指定(1~999)
④フォルダ名、元フォルダ内にあるフォルダをファイルとして分けるか、
元フォルダ内にあるフォルダの中のファイルも分けるか、
元フォルダ内にあるフォルダは無視するか等オプション設定
⑤[実行]を押すと移動先フォルダに、オプションで指定したフォルダ名のフォルダを作り
元フォルダ内のファイルを指定数分移動していく。
元フォルダ内が空になったら終わる。
というただのファイル移動アプリケーションなのですが
C言語で組むのとJava言語で組むのならどちらが簡単か予想できますか?
OSはWindowsXPです。
C言語は一通り学んだのですが、WinAPIは使ったことがありませんので一から勉強するつもりです
Java言語は全く知りませんのでこちらも一から勉強するつもりです
どちらにせよプログラミング初心者なので単純にどちらを学べばいいかアドバイスお願いします
C言語かJava言語か・・・
- softya(ソフト屋)
- 副管理人
- 記事: 11677
- 登録日時: 15年前
- 住所: 東海地方
- 連絡を取る:
Re: C言語かJava言語か・・・
GUIを作るのはJavaの方が楽だと思います。ただ、Javaを理解するのはそれなりに大変です。
CUIでよければ、大したWindowsAPIは使わないので理解しているC言語が楽でしょう。
※ 要件だけ見るとGUIは必要なさそうです。
GUIの場合、いっその事C#で作ったほうが楽かもしれません。
CUIでよければ、大したWindowsAPIは使わないので理解しているC言語が楽でしょう。
※ 要件だけ見るとGUIは必要なさそうです。
GUIの場合、いっその事C#で作ったほうが楽かもしれません。
by softya(ソフト屋) 方針:私は仕組み・考え方を理解して欲しいので直接的なコードを回答することはまれですので、すぐコードがほしい方はその旨をご明記下さい。私以外の方と交代したいと思います(代わりの方がいる保証は出来かねます)。